The inaugural Access All Areas Conference & Awards saw live event professionals from across the industry recognised for their outstanding achievement in 2022.

Among the winners at the event at EartH in London yesterday, 12 January, were From The Fields, which was declared event promoter of the year, and FKP Scorpio Entertainment collected best visitor experience for Jurassic World Exhibition.

S&C Productions picked up the best launch event award for The Cambridge Club Festival, while Mustard Media and the Camp Bestival team were recognised for best marketing campaign for their work on Camp Bestival Shropshire, and Far and Beyond Events was declared Employer of The Year.

The Legacy award, which celebrates an event that has had a long-term positive impact on the local community, was won by Towersey Festival.

Among the many individuals recognised during the ceremony were Kilimanjaro Live head of production Dave Hale who won best production manager, LS Events senior site manager Iain Rogers collected the best site manager award, and Caitlin Ford was declared the rising star.

Access All Areas content director Christopher Barrett said, “During testing times last year there was no shortage of excellence, endurance and creative endeavour demonstrated across the industry. The Access All Areas Awards was created to recognise the sterling work of promoters, production companies, venue operators and freelancers across the industry, not just in live music but across sports and cultural events. There was a focus on recognising newcomers, and excellence across key areas such as social impact, sustainability, and diversity.

“Congratulations to all the well-deserved winners, and many thanks to our event partners and sponsors including Arena Group, Tysers Insurance Brokers, SA Event Management Solutions Worldwide and Catalytic Solutions.”
